US SAILING Launches New Website for U.S. Olympic and Paralympic Sailing Teams

Portsmouth, R.I (May 21, 2008) US SAILING, national governing body for the sport, is pleased to announce it has launched a new website dedicated to members of the 2008 U.S. Olympic and Paralympic Sailing Teams. Athlete bios, event schedules, photos, news, press releases and more information can be found at this web address: www2.ussailing.org/site3.aspx.

As the Olympic Games approach, look to this new homepage for everything from short announcements to interviews, stories and press releases. During the Olympic Regatta August 8-24, this site will be updated daily with news, blogs and pictures from China.

About US SAILING
The United States Sailing Association (US SAILING) is the national governing body for sailing. Founded in 1897 and headquartered in Portsmouth, Rhode Island, the organization provides leadership for the sport of sailing in the U.S. US SAILING offers training and education programs for instructors and race officials, supports a wide range of sailing organizations and communities, issues offshore rating certificates, and provides administration and oversight of competitive sailing across the country, including National Championships and the U.S. Olympic and Paralympic Sailing Teams.
